Installing a replacement Replus-250/ Replus-250A/B
Disconnecng a Replus-250/ Replus-250A/B from the PV Module
1. Aach the replacement Replus-250/ Replus-250A/B to the PV module rack using hardware
recommended by your module rack vendor. If you are using grounding washers (e.g., WEEB) to
ground the chassis of the Replus-250/ Replus-250A/B, the old grounding washer should be
discarded and a new grounding washer must be used when installing the replacement
Replus-250/ Replus-250A/B. Torque the Replus-250/ Replus-250A/B fasteners to the values
listed below:
1/4” mounng hardware – 45 in-lbs minimum.
5/16” mounng hardware – 80 in-lbs minimum.
2. If you are using a grounding electrode conductor to ground the Replus-250/ Replus-250A/B
chassis, aach the grounding electrode conductor to the Replus-250/ Replus-250A/B ground
clamp.
3. Connect the AC cable of the replacementReplus-250/ Replus-250A/B and the neighboring
Replus-250/ Replus-250A/B to complete the branch circuit connecons.
4. Complete the connecon map and connect the PV Modules
1) Complete the connecon map.
2) Each Replus-250/ Replus-250A/B has a removable serial number label located on the
mounng plate. Enter this serial number into the MRG, and correspond it to a number in the
connecon map.
3) Connect the PV Modules.
4) Completely install all Replus-250/ Replus-250A/B and all system inter-wiring connecons
prior to installing the PV modules.
a) Mount the PV modules above their corresponding Replus-250/ Replus-250A/B. Each
Replus-250/ Replus-250A/B comes with one male and one female DC connector.
b) First connect the posive DC wire from the PV module to the negavely marked DC
connector (male pin) of the R Replus-250/ Replus-250A/B. Then connect the negave DC
wire from the PV module to the posively marked DC connector (female socket) of the
Replus-250/ Replus-250A/B.
Repeat for all remaining PV modules using one Replus-250/ Replus-250A/B for each module.
To ensure the Replus-250/ Replus-250A/B is not disconnected from the PV modules under load,
adhere to the following disconnecon steps in the order shown:
1. Disconnect the AC by opening the branch circuit breaker.
2. Disconnect the first AC connector in the branch circuit.
3. Cover the module with an opaque cover.
4. Using a DC current probe, verify there is no current flowing in the DC wires between the PV
module and the Replus-250/ Replus-250A/B.
5. Care should be taken when measuring DC currents, as most clamp-on meters must be zeroed
first and tend to dri with me.
6. Disconnect the PV module DC wire connectors from the Replus-250/ Replus-250A/B.
7. Remove the Replus-250/ Replus-250A/B from the PV array rack.

Warning: Never Disconnect The Dc Wire Connectors Under Load. Ensure That No Current Is
Flowing Inthe Dc Wires Prior To Disconnecng. An Opaque Covering Maybe Used To Cover
The Module Prior To Disconnecng The Module.
Warning: Always Disconnect Ac Power Before Disconnecng The Pv Module Wires From
Replus-250/ Replus-250a/b. The Ac Connector Of The First Replus-250/ Replus-250a/b In A
Branch Circuis Suitable As A Disconnecng Means Once The Ac Branch Circuit Breaker In
The Load Center Has Been Opened.

LED indicaon of error
• Error report: AC or DC fault
The LED light is on by 4 seconds, and off by 4 seconds.
• Error report: GFDI fault
The LED light stays on.
Troubleshoong an Inoperable Replus-250/ Replus-250A/B
7. TROUBLESHOOTING AND MAINTENANCE
To troubleshoot an inoperable Replus-250/ Replus-250A/B, follow the steps in the order shown:
1. Check the connecon to the ulity grid. Verify that the ulity voltage and frequency are within
allowable ranges shown in the label of the Replus-250/ Replus-250A/B.
2. Verify ulity power is present at the inverter in queson by removing AC, then DC power.
Never disconnect the DC wires while the Replus-250/ Replus-250A/B is producing power.
Re-connect the DC module connectors, and then watch for the LED blinks.
3. Check the AC branch circuit interconnecon harness between all the Replus-250/
Replus-250A/B’s. Verify that each inverter is energized by the ulity grid as described in the
previous step.
4. Make sure that any AC disconnects are funconing properly and are closed.
5. Verify the PV module DC voltage is within the allowable range shown in the label of the
Replus-250/ Replus-250A/B.
6. Check the DC connecons between the Replus-250/ Replus-250A/B and the PV module.
7. If the problem persists, please contact ReneSola customer support.
